Understanding Critical Hardware Compatibility
To fully experience the visual capabilities of the Xbox Series X, your chosen display system must feature specific connectivity standards. The console utilizes HDMI 2.1 bandwidth to transmit 4K video signals at a smooth 120Hz refresh rate. Many traditional home theater models are limited to HDMI 2.0, which caps performance at 4K at 60Hz or 1080p at 120Hz.
When shopping for new equipment, look specifically for units advertised with low latency gaming configurations and high refresh rate support. Newer gaming models are explicitly designed to handle variable refresh rates and automatic low-latency modes. Utilizing a high-speed premium HDMI cable is equally critical to prevent signal drops or visual artifacts during intense gaming sessions.
Optimizing Video Settings and Latency
Input lag is the most crucial metric for interactive entertainment, as high latency can make fast-paced games feel sluggish and unresponsive. Most modern projection systems feature a dedicated Game Mode that bypasses unnecessary image processing to minimize delay. Activating this setting can drop response times down to competitive levels, rivaling traditional flat panels.
Once the physical hardware is securely connected, navigating to the console's advanced video settings allows you to calibrate the output signal. Ensuring features like YCC 4:2:2 or 10-bit color depth match your display's capabilities will maximize visual fidelity. If you are routing your connection through an external audio receiver, ensure the device supports eARC pass-through to maintain synced audio.
Perfecting the Room Environment and Placement
Unlike standard televisions, projected images are highly sensitive to ambient light, which can wash out colors and ruin contrast. Setting up your gaming station in a dedicated room with blackout curtains or controlled lighting creates the ideal environment. Additionally, pairing your console with a specialized ambient light rejecting screen will dramatically enhance brightness and deep black levels.
Physical placement also dictates your overall image quality, requiring careful calculation of throw distance and screen alignment. Avoid relying heavily on digital keystone correction, as this adjustment can introduce minor visual compression and slightly increase input lag.
